Standard Phacoemulsification for a Nonstandard Case

Show Description +

In this video we describe the case of a patient with acute angle closure due to a hypermature cataract and secondary phacolytic glaucoma, for whom we performed cataract extraction by phacoemulsification. We describe the technique, highlighting the precautions that the surgeon needs to take during the procedure and we share some tips and tricks for a successful surgery in such a difficult case.
